diff --git a/packages/common/package.json b/packages/common/package.json index f578e181..891d3677 100644 --- a/packages/common/package.json +++ b/packages/common/package.json @@ -14,7 +14,7 @@ "author": "", "license": "ISC", "devDependencies": { - "@fastify/swagger": "8.15.0", + "@fastify/swagger": "9.4.1", "@fastify/swagger-ui": "4.2.0", "@types/jest": "29.5.14", "@types/lodash": "4.17.13", @@ -25,7 +25,7 @@ "typescript": "5.7.2" }, "peerDependencies": { - "@fastify/swagger": "8.15.0", + "@fastify/swagger": "9.4.1", "@fastify/swagger-ui": "4.2.0", "fastify": "4.29.0" }, diff --git a/playground/integration-tests/package.json b/playground/integration-tests/package.json index bb7d2a73..7e75bae5 100644 --- a/playground/integration-tests/package.json +++ b/playground/integration-tests/package.json @@ -15,7 +15,7 @@ "author": "", "license": "ISC", "dependencies": { - "@fastify/swagger": "8.15.0", + "@fastify/swagger": "9.4.1", "fastify": "4.29.0", "fastify-flux": "workspace:*", "source-map-support": "0.5.21", diff --git a/playground/template-prisma/package.json b/playground/template-prisma/package.json index f73879ba..b1c34418 100644 --- a/playground/template-prisma/package.json +++ b/playground/template-prisma/package.json @@ -17,7 +17,7 @@ "author": "", "license": "ISC", "dependencies": { - "@fastify/swagger": "8.15.0", + "@fastify/swagger": "9.4.1", "@fastify/swagger-ui": "4.2.0", "@prisma/client": "5.22.0", "fastify": "4.29.0", diff --git a/pnpm-lock.yaml b/pnpm-lock.yaml index 403f9ba0..6f7c03de 100644 --- a/pnpm-lock.yaml +++ b/pnpm-lock.yaml @@ -89,8 +89,8 @@ importers: version: 4.17.21 devDependencies: '@fastify/swagger': - specifier: 8.15.0 - version: 8.15.0 + specifier: 9.4.1 + version: 9.4.1 '@fastify/swagger-ui': specifier: 4.2.0 version: 4.2.0 @@ -175,8 +175,8 @@ importers: playground/integration-tests: dependencies: '@fastify/swagger': - specifier: 8.15.0 - version: 8.15.0 + specifier: 9.4.1 + version: 9.4.1 fastify: specifier: 4.29.0 version: 4.29.0 @@ -233,8 +233,8 @@ importers: playground/template-prisma: dependencies: '@fastify/swagger': - specifier: 8.15.0 - version: 8.15.0 + specifier: 9.4.1 + version: 9.4.1 '@fastify/swagger-ui': specifier: 4.2.0 version: 4.2.0 @@ -1356,14 +1356,14 @@ packages: rfdc: 1.3.0 yaml: 2.3.4 - /@fastify/swagger@8.15.0: - resolution: {integrity: sha512-zy+HEEKFqPMS2sFUsQU5X0MHplhKJvWeohBwTCkBAJA/GDYGLGUWQaETEhptiqxK7Hs0fQB9B4MDb3pbwIiCwA==} + /@fastify/swagger@9.4.1: + resolution: {integrity: sha512-VyQ0tTPYIvjHaaIStrXajTEx2xBf0FjYkXfm6GPWA/aCk5q+85Jl//F37BwxUAC5u4lMColWkktCQfczE3WBrQ==} dependencies: - fastify-plugin: 4.5.1 + fastify-plugin: 5.0.1 json-schema-resolver: 2.0.0 openapi-types: 12.1.3 - rfdc: 1.3.0 - yaml: 2.3.4 + rfdc: 1.4.1 + yaml: 2.7.0 transitivePeerDependencies: - supports-color @@ -3344,6 +3344,9 @@ packages: /fastify-plugin@4.5.1: resolution: {integrity: sha512-stRHYGeuqpEZTL1Ef0Ovr2ltazUT9g844X5z/zEBFLG8RYlpDiOCIG+ATvYEp+/zmc7sN29mcIMp8gvYplYPIQ==} + /fastify-plugin@5.0.1: + resolution: {integrity: sha512-HCxs+YnRaWzCl+cWRYFnHmeRFyR5GVnJTAaCJQiYzQSDwK9MgJdyAsuL3nh0EWRCYMgQ5MeziymvmAhUHYHDUQ==} + /fastify@4.29.0: resolution: {integrity: sha512-MaaUHUGcCgC8fXQDsDtioaCcag1fmPJ9j64vAKunqZF4aSub040ZGi/ag8NGE2714yREPOKZuHCfpPzuUD3UQQ==} dependencies: @@ -4540,7 +4543,7 @@ packages: engines: {node: '>=10'} dependencies: debug: 4.3.4 - rfdc: 1.3.0 + rfdc: 1.4.1 uri-js: 4.4.1 transitivePeerDependencies: - supports-color @@ -5454,6 +5457,9 @@ packages: /rfdc@1.3.0: resolution: {integrity: sha512-V2hovdzFbOi77/WajaSMXk2OLm+xNIeQdMMuB7icj7bk6zi2F8GGAxigcnDFpJHbNyNcgyJDiP+8nOrY5cZGrA==} + /rfdc@1.4.1: + resolution: {integrity: sha512-q1b3N5QkRUWUl7iyylaaj3kOpIT0N2i9MqIEQXP73GVsN9cw3fdx8X63cEmWhJGi2PPCF23Ijp7ktmd39rawIA==} + /rsvp@4.8.5: resolution: {integrity: sha512-nfMOlASu9OnRJo1mbEk2cz0D56a1MBNrJ7orjRZQG10XDyuvwksKbuXNp6qa+kbn839HwjwhBzhFmdsaEAfauA==} engines: {node: 6.* || >= 7.*} @@ -6205,6 +6211,11 @@ packages: resolution: {integrity: sha512-8aAvwVUSHpfEqTQ4w/KMlf3HcRdt50E5ODIQJBw1fQ5RL34xabzxtUlzTXVqc4rkZsPbvrXKWnABCD7kWSmocA==} engines: {node: '>= 14'} + /yaml@2.7.0: + resolution: {integrity: sha512-+hSoy/QHluxmC9kCIJyL/uyFmLmc+e5CFR5Wa+bpIhIj85LVb9ZH2nVnqrHoSvKogwODv0ClqZkmiSSaIH5LTA==} + engines: {node: '>= 14'} + hasBin: true + /yargs-parser@21.1.1: resolution: {integrity: sha512-tVpsJW7DdjecAiFpbIB1e3qxIQsE6NoPc5/eTdrbbIC4h0LVsWhnoa3g+m2HclBIujHzsxZ4VJVA+GUuc2/LBw==} engines: {node: '>=12'}